Analysis of Crypto Account Top-ups: What Drives Capital Movement

The process of replenishing cryptocurrency accounts is not just a technical operation, but a crucial indicator of market sentiment. In recent weeks, I have observed a steady trend: the volume of incoming transactions to major exchanges and DeFi protocols is showing noticeable growth. This suggests that investors who were waiting out the period of high volatility are beginning to return liquidity to the system.

Particularly indicative is the increase in the average replenishment amount among institutional wallets. While small retail transfers previously dominated, we are now seeing structured deposits of $50,000 and above. This is a classic signal of preparation for large deals or position accumulation ahead of an expected market move.

Technically, the replenishment process has become significantly safer today. Modern protocols use multi-level verification and automated AML screening systems. However, as an analyst, I recommend always checking the network status before sending funds — an error in choosing the blockchain can lead to the irreversible loss of assets.

From a macroeconomic perspective, the current surge in replenishments coincides with a weakening of the dollar index and expectations of new monetary stimulus from the Fed. Cryptocurrencies are once again becoming a risk hedging tool, and smart money understands this perfectly.
